You should have received a copy of the GNU General Public License   along with this program; if not, write to the Free Software Foundation,   Inc., 51 Franklin Street - Fifth Floor, Boston, MA 02110-1301, USA.  *//* These two enums are from rel_apu/common/spu_asm_format.h *//* definition of instruction format */typedef enum {  RRR,  RI18,  RI16,  RI10,  RI8,  RI7,  RR,  LBT,  LBTI,  IDATA,  UNKNOWN_IFORMAT} spu_iformat;/* These values describe assembly instruction arguments.  They indicate * how to encode, range checking and which relocation to use. */typedef enum {  A_T,  /* register at pos 0 */  A_A,  /* register at pos 7 */  A_B,  /* register at pos 14 */  A_C,  /* register at pos 21 */  A_S,  /* special purpose register at pos 7 */  A_H,  /* channel register at pos 7 */  A_P,  /* parenthesis, this has to separate regs from immediates */  A_S3,  A_S6,  A_S7N,  A_S7,  A_U7A,  A_U7B,  A_S10B,  A_S10,  A_S11,  A_S11I,  A_S14,  A_S16,  A_S18,  A_R18,  A_U3,  A_U5,  A_U6,  A_U7,  A_U14,  A_X16,  A_U18,  A_MAX} spu_aformat;enum spu_insns {#define APUOP(TAG,MACFORMAT,OPCODE,MNEMONIC,ASMFORMAT,DEP,PIPE) \	TAG,#define APUOPFB(TAG,MACFORMAT,OPCODE,FB,MNEMONIC,ASMFORMAT,DEP,PIPE) \	TAG,#include "spu-insns.h"#undef APUOP#undef APUOPFB        M_SPU_MAX};struct spu_opcode{   spu_iformat insn_type;   unsigned int opcode;   char *mnemonic;   int arg[5];};#define SIGNED_EXTRACT(insn,size,pos) (((int)((insn) << (32-size-pos))) >> (32-size))#define UNSIGNED_EXTRACT(insn,size,pos) (((insn) >> pos) & ((1 << size)-1))#define DECODE_INSN_RT(insn) (insn & 0x7f)#define DECODE_INSN_RA(insn) ((insn >> 7) & 0x7f)#define DECODE_INSN_RB(insn) ((insn >> 14) & 0x7f)#define DECODE_INSN_RC(insn) ((insn >> 21) & 0x7f)#define DECODE_INSN_I10(insn) SIGNED_EXTRACT(insn,10,14)#define DECODE_INSN_U10(insn) UNSIGNED_EXTRACT(insn,10,14)/* For branching, immediate loads, hbr and  lqa/stqa. */#define DECODE_INSN_I16(insn) SIGNED_EXTRACT(insn,16,7)#define DECODE_INSN_U16(insn) UNSIGNED_EXTRACT(insn,16,7)/* for stop */#define DECODE_INSN_U14(insn) UNSIGNED_EXTRACT(insn,14,0)/* For ila */#define DECODE_INSN_I18(insn) SIGNED_EXTRACT(insn,18,7)#define DECODE_INSN_U18(insn) UNSIGNED_EXTRACT(insn,18,7)/* For rotate and shift and generate control mask */#define DECODE_INSN_I7(insn) SIGNED_EXTRACT(insn,7,14)#define DECODE_INSN_U7(insn) UNSIGNED_EXTRACT(insn,7,14)/* For float <-> int conversion */#define DECODE_INSN_I8(insn)  SIGNED_EXTRACT(insn,8,14)#define DECODE_INSN_U8(insn) UNSIGNED_EXTRACT(insn,8,14)/* For hbr  */#define DECODE_INSN_I9a(insn) ((SIGNED_EXTRACT(insn,2,23) << 7) | UNSIGNED_EXTRACT(insn,7,0))#define DECODE_INSN_I9b(insn) ((SIGNED_EXTRACT(insn,2,14) << 7) | UNSIGNED_EXTRACT(insn,7,0))#define DECODE_INSN_U9a(insn) ((UNSIGNED_EXTRACT(insn,2,23) << 7) | UNSIGNED_EXTRACT(insn,7,0))#define DECODE_INSN_U9b(insn) ((UNSIGNED_EXTRACT(insn,2,14) << 7) | UNSIGNED_EXTRACT(insn,7,0))
